Closed petition Reduction in the amount of Overseas Aid from public funds
Closed on
That the Department for International Development should receive no funding from general tax revenues from 2013 and that the saving should be returned to the general public by a reduction of 1p in the Basic Rate of Income Tax.
From 2013 the Department for International Development should publish its plans for overseas aid and invite those members of the public who wish to support those plans to contribute by way of a voluntary levy on their income of 1p per £1.00 on that part of their income that would have been subject to tax, such levy to be collected by HMRC and paid to the Department for International Development.
